Stone terrace installation services involve creating durable, attractive outdoor surfaces using natural stone materials such as flagstone, slate, or granite. These services typically include designing and laying a stone patio or terrace that enhances the functionality and aesthetic appeal of a property’s outdoor space. Skilled contractors prepare the ground, ensure proper leveling, and use appropriate techniques to secure the stones, resulting in a stable surface suitable for seating areas, walkways, or entertainment spaces. Homeowners often choose stone terrace installation to add a timeless, natural element to their yard while providing a versatile area for outdoor activities.

This service helps address common problems associated with traditional concrete or asphalt surfaces, such as cracking, uneven settling, and excessive maintenance. A professionally installed stone terrace offers improved durability and resistance to weather conditions like rain and snow, which are common in Gaithersburg, MD. It also helps prevent issues related to poor drainage or shifting ground, reducing the need for frequent repairs. For homeowners seeking a low-maintenance, long-lasting outdoor feature that combines function with visual appeal, stone terrace installation provides a practical solution.

The overview below groups typical Stone Terrace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Gaithersburg, MD.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- For minor stone terrace repairs or patching,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ine fixes fall within this range, depending on the scope of work and materials needed.

Mid-Range Projects - Installing new stone terraces or replacing sections usually costs between $1,500 and $3,500. Most projects of this size are priced within this band, with fewer reaching higher amounts for more complex designs.

Full Terrace Installations - Complete installation of a new stone terrace can range from $4,000 to $8,000 or more, depending on size and materials. Larger, more detailed projects tend to fall into this higher range, but many are completed at the lower end.

Complex or Custom Designs - Highly intricate or large-scale stone terrace projects can exceed $10,000, especially for custom patterns or extensive landscaping. These are less common but represent the upper end of typical project costs handled by local pros.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of installing a stone terrace? A stone terrace can enhance outdoor aesthetics, provide a durable surface for outdoor activities, and increase property value in Gaithersburg, MD and nearby areas.

How do local contractors prepare for stone terrace installation? They typically assess the site, design the layout, and prepare the ground to ensure a stable and long-lasting stone surface.

What types of stones are commonly used for terrace installations? Popular options include flagstone, slate, and limestone, each offering different textures and appearances suitable for outdoor spaces.

Can a stone terrace be customized to fit different outdoor spaces? Yes, local service providers can customize the design, shape, and pattern of the stone terrace to complement the property's landscape.

What maintenance is involved with a stone terrace? Maintenance generally includes regular cleaning and occasional resealing to preserve the appearance and durability of the stones.
